HC Deb 23 July 1987 vol 120 c363W
Mr. Douglas

asked the Prime Minister whether, in her meetings with President Reagan, she had an opportunity of discussing the effect upon British and American telecommunications interests of further delay in negotiations for the second KKD international telecommunications network in Japan.

The Prime Minister

I refer the hon. Member to the reply I gave my hon. Friend the Member for Arundel (Mr. Marshall) yesterday.

Mr. Michael Marshall

asked the Prime Minister whether she had an opportunity of discussing with President Reagan the common interests of the United Kingdom and the United States of America in a speedy resolution to the negotiations for the second KDD international telecommunications network in Japan.

The Prime Minister

No. The United States administration, however, are well aware of our views.
